Output 79b8fa0451de06e3ff641d16635bc534cd4aa355b2e4dc5fc4c175fc42cbfeaf:0

value
78597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9ef12c8559cd568d1dbc8f6f17179b28e04cf20 OP_EQUAL
address
3MZLxHBjiqkCuDpkEiZdVen4JGBtrrgzzp
transaction
79b8fa0451de06e3ff641d16635bc534cd4aa355b2e4dc5fc4c175fc42cbfeaf
confirmations
170722
spent
true